温馨提示×

Debian PgAdmin界面功能详解

小樊
64
2025-06-27 13:18:27
栏目: 智能运维

Debian PgAdmin界面功能详解

简介

pgAdmin4 是一款开源的 PostgreSQL 数据库图形管理工具,适用于 Linux、Windows 和 macOS 平台。它提供直观、功能强大的界面,使用户能够方便地进行数据库的连接、管理、备份和恢复等操作。

安装过程

使用图形界面安装程序

  1. 访问 PgAdmin 官方网站,在“Debian/Ubuntu”部分找到适合的版本并下载。
  2. 下载完成后,打开终端,导航到下载目录,运行以下命令来启动安装程序:
    sudo dpkg -i pgadmin4-x.x.x-pgadmin4-linux-x64.deb 
    其中,x.x.x 是你下载的 PgAdmin 版本号。
  3. 如果在安装过程中遇到依赖问题,可以运行以下命令来自动解决依赖关系:
    sudo apt-get install -f 

使用包管理器

  1. 打开终端,更新包列表:
    sudo apt update 
  2. 安装 PgAdmin:
    sudo apt install pgadmin4 # 对于 Debian 10 (Buster) 及以上版本 # 或者 sudo apt install pgadmin3 # 对于 Debian 9 (Stretch) 
  3. 安装完成后,可以通过在浏览器中输入 http://localhost:5050 来访问 PgAdmin 的 Web 界面。

配置过程

配置 pgAdmin

  1. 创建启动器: 创建一个名为 pgadmin4.desktop 的文件:

    sudo nano /usr/share/applications/pgadmin4.desktop 

    将以下内容粘贴到文件中:

    [Desktop Entry] Name=pgAdmin Comment=PostgreSQL Database Manager Exec=/opt/pgadmin/bin/pgadmin4 Icon=/opt/pgadmin/share/pgadmin/images/pgadmin4.svg Terminal=false Type=Application Categories=Development;Database; 

    保存并退出编辑器。

  2. 配置服务器连接: 打开浏览器,访问 http://your_server_ip:5050,其中 your_server_ip 是运行 PgAdmin 的服务器的 IP 地址。

    • 输入有效的 PostgreSQL 用户名和密码进行登录。
    • 登录后,点击左上角的“+”号,选择“Server…”,输入服务器的名称、IP地址、端口(默认为 5432)、用户名和密码,根据需要选择 SSL 连接选项,然后点击“Save”保存设置。

常用功能详解

SQL 查询编辑器

  • 用于编写和执行 SQL 语句,支持语法高亮、自动完成和错误检查等功能,极大地方便了 SQL 开发人员。

对象浏览器

  • 提供一个树状视图,显示和管理数据库中的各种对象,如数据库和表、视图、函数、索引等。用户可以通过直观的方式浏览和操作这些对象。

导入/导出工具

  • 支持多种数据格式的导入和导出,包括 CSV、JSON、Excel 等,方便数据的迁移和备份。

备份与恢复

  • 提供数据库的备份和恢复功能,支持完整的数据备份和增量备份,确保数据安全。

权限管理

  • 可以设置和管理用户对数据库对象的访问权限,支持细粒度的权限控制,确保数据库的安全性。

性能优化

  • 提供实时性能监控工具,如连接数、锁状态和缓存命中率等,帮助用户优化数据库性能。

故障排除

  • 无法启动 PgAdmin:检查是否正确安装了所有依赖项。
  • 查看日志文件:日志文件通常位于 ~/.pgadmin/pgadmin4.log,通过查看日志可以获取详细的错误信息。
  • 防火墙设置:确保防火墙允许 PgAdmin 使用的端口(默认是 5050)。

通过以上步骤和功能详解,您可以在 Debian 系统上顺利安装、配置和使用 PgAdmin,从而高效地管理您的 PostgreSQL 数据库。如果在操作过程中遇到问题,可以参考官方文档或社区论坛寻求帮助。

0